Understanding the Core Elements of a Sample Letter of Commitment for Project

First, let’s break down what makes a commitment letter effective. Most letters include three core sections: an introductory statement that identifies the parties and project, a section that details the commitments and responsibilities, and a closing that confirms agreement and sets next steps. The clarity and precision in these parts reduce misunderstandings.

This clear structure is essential because it creates a shared reference point for everyone involved. When both parties know exactly what is expected, they can focus on execution rather than disputes.   • Introduction: Who, What, and Why
  • Commitments: Scope, Deliverables, and Timelines
  • Closing: Signatures, Dates, and Follow‑up Actions
Component Key Information Why It Matters
Parties Identified Full legal names and addresses Ensures legal standing and reduces confusion
Project Scope Specific tasks, goals, and metrics Sets measurable expectations
Timeline Start date, milestones, completion date Keeps project on schedule

In practice, these elements combine to form a document that is both legally solid and easily understandable by non‑legal stakeholders.

Sample Letter of Commitment for Project: Securing a Funding Agreement

Subject: Commitment to Funding the Green Energy Initiative, Inc. (Project ID: GEI–2026)

Dear Ms. Ramirez,

Thank you for reviewing our proposal for the Green Energy Initiative. We are excited to confirm our commitment to providing the requested $250,000 in seed funding. This letter outlines our agreement and the expectations for both parties:

  • Funding Amount: $250,000 CAD, payable in two installments—$125,000 upon project kickoff and $125,000 upon completion of Phase 1.
  • Use of Funds: Resources will be strictly allocated to research, prototype development, and regulatory compliance.
  • Reporting: Quarterly financial statements and milestones reports will be delivered to your office.
  • Duration: The funding commitment is valid for 12 months from the date of signing.

We understand the importance of transparency and will provide all necessary documentation by the end of next week. Once we receive your signature, we will process the first disbursement within 10 business days.

Thank you for entrusting us with this opportunity. We look forward to a successful collaboration.

Sincerely,
Simon Leclerc
Chief Financial Officer
Green Energy Initiative, Inc.

Sample Letter of Commitment for Project: Partnering with a Vendor

Subject: Commitment to Vendor Collaboration for the SmartClinic Platform

Dear Mr. Patel,

I am pleased to extend our commitment to partner with your company, TechNova Solutions, in developing the SmartClinic Platform. We have reviewed your service portfolio and are confident that your expertise aligns with our project goals.

Vendor Responsibility Deliverable Due Date
Software Architecture Design Complete design documentation May 31, 2026
API Development RESTful endpoints for patient data July 15, 2026
Quality Assurance Test plan and execution report August 30, 2026

In return, our organization will provide:

  • Full access to our data analytics suite.
  • A dedicated project manager for seamless communication.
  • Monthly budgetary allocations totaling $120,000 for development costs.

Both parties agree to a non-disclosure agreement (NDA) signed on the same date as this letter. Please review and sign below if you accept these terms.

Best regards,
Laura Chen
Director of Product Development
HealthTech Solutions

Sample Letter of Commitment for Project: Initiating a Joint Venture

Subject: Joint Venture Commitment for the Coastal E‑Commerce Expansion

Dear Ms. Gomez,

Following our recent discussions, we are delighted to formalize our commitment to a joint venture (JV) with Oceanic Retail Group. Our shared vision is to launch a new e‑commerce platform serving coastal regions by Q3 2027.

Our JV agreement outlines the following commitments:

  • Capital Investment: Each partner contributes $500,000 in equity capital.
  • Resource Allocation: 60% of our marketing budget and 40% of your fulfillment center capacity will be dedicated to the JV.
  • Governance: A joint steering committee will meet monthly to review performance and make strategic decisions.
  • Profit Sharing: Net profits will be distributed 50/50 after covering operating expenses.

We have attached the draft JV charter for your review. Please sign the letter below and return it within 10 business days to expedite the formation process.

We look forward to creating a powerful partnership that drives growth and customer satisfaction.

Kind regards,
David Naylor
CEO, CoastalTech Solutions

Sample Letter of Commitment for Project: Sending a Freelance Contractor Confirmation

Subject: Confirmation of Engagement – Content Marketing Specialist

Hi Alex,

We are thrilled to confirm your engagement as a freelance content marketing specialist for our upcoming product launch. Below are the key details of this commitment:

  1. Scope of Work: Create 12 pieces of long‑form content (blog posts, whitepapers, case studies) and manage related social media outreach over a 3‑month period.
  2. Compensation: $1,200 per piece, with a 10% bonus for early delivery. Total engagement value: $18,000.
  3. Payment Schedule: 50% upfront ($9,000) and the remaining 50% upon delivery of the final content set.
  4. Timeline: Commence on September 1, 2026, with a final deadline of November 30, 2026.
  5. Tools and Access: You will receive login credentials for our CMS, analytics dashboard, and editorial calendar.

We believe your expertise aligns perfectly with our goals, and we are excited to see the impact of your work. Please sign below to acknowledge your agreement to these terms.

Thanks again for joining us—you’ll be a key player in our next big campaign.

Best,
Megan Lee
Marketing Lead, BrightFuture Inc.
